🙂A single person spends $1,084 per month in Rakvere vs $1,915 in Tallinn,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$1,665 per month in Rakvere vs $2,967 in Tallinn,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$2,245 per month in Rakvere vs $4,018 in Tallinn, rent included.
🙂Rakvere is about 43% cheaper than Tallinn,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Rakvere sits 21% below the global median, while Tallinn is 39% above –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

💰Salaries run about 83% higher in Tallinn,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$68.0 in Rakvere versus $94.0 in Tallinn.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$237 vs $317 – making Rakvere the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
